Understanding the Open Source Imaging Consortium (OSIC)

So, what exactly is the Open Source Imaging Consortium (OSIC)? At its core, OSIC is a collaborative effort aimed at promoting and developing open-source solutions for imaging. Think of it as a hub where researchers, developers, clinicians, and industry professionals come together to build, share, and improve imaging tools and technologies. This means that the software, algorithms, and data produced by OSIC are freely available for anyone to use, modify, and distribute. This open-source approach fosters transparency, encourages innovation, and breaks down barriers that often hinder progress in the imaging world. This is a big deal, guys! The medical field, for example, is often plagued by expensive proprietary software. OSIC provides an accessible, affordable alternative. This allows for increased collaboration and the rapid development of new techniques. OSIC's mission goes beyond just creating software; it's about building a community. This collaborative environment is built on the principles of open access and knowledge-sharing. OSIC supports educational programs, workshops, and resources for users of all levels. Whether you are a seasoned expert or a curious beginner, there is a place for you in the OSIC community!

One of the main goals of OSIC is to improve access to advanced imaging technologies. By making these technologies open source, OSIC reduces the costs associated with proprietary software. This allows hospitals, research institutions, and individual practitioners to leverage advanced imaging tools without the financial burden. This approach is especially beneficial in resource-constrained environments. By enabling access, OSIC empowers researchers and healthcare providers globally. The result is a more equitable distribution of innovative solutions. OSIC also emphasizes interoperability, ensuring different systems work seamlessly together. This is a critical factor for improving efficiency and providing comprehensive patient care.

The Importance of Open Source in Imaging

Why is open source so important in the realm of imaging? Well, it's pretty simple. Traditional, closed-source systems can be limiting. They often restrict access, hinder collaboration, and slow down progress. Open-source solutions, on the other hand, unlock a whole new world of possibilities. First off, transparency is a huge advantage. With open-source software, the source code is readily available for anyone to inspect. This promotes accountability and allows for rigorous testing and validation, which is crucial in medical applications. The ability to modify and adapt the code to specific needs is another major benefit. This flexibility allows researchers and clinicians to customize tools to meet their unique requirements. They can develop cutting-edge solutions to specific problems. Open-source also fosters collaboration on a global scale. Developers from around the world can contribute to projects, share their expertise, and build upon each other's work. This leads to faster innovation and more robust solutions. Key Projects and Initiatives by OSIC

Okay, so what has OSIC actually done? The consortium has been involved in several key projects and initiatives that are making a real difference in the world of imaging. OSIC's projects span a variety of areas. Each initiative emphasizes open-source principles and community collaboration. From software development to data sharing, OSIC's efforts are driving innovation and improving access to critical tools. One of the flagship initiatives is the development of open-source image analysis software. These tools are designed to provide researchers and clinicians with powerful capabilities for processing, analyzing, and visualizing imaging data. These tools are often created with specific medical applications in mind. This allows users to perform tasks like segmenting tumors, measuring organ volumes, and tracking disease progression. OSIC supports several open-source data repositories. These provide researchers with access to large, high-quality datasets that can be used to train and validate imaging algorithms. These datasets are invaluable for developing new diagnostic tools and advancing medical knowledge. By making these datasets available, OSIC accelerates the pace of research and discovery.

Another key area of focus is the development of standardized data formats and communication protocols. These standards ensure interoperability between different imaging systems. They make it easier for researchers and clinicians to share and analyze data from various sources. This is essential for collaborative research.
